Brain Based Learning

From Human Brain, Human Learning by Leslie Hart

 

¬Learning is the extraction, from confusion of meaningful patterns.

¬The brain is a pattern-seeking device.  Patterns help children find meaning

 

Suggestions by Hart

¬Provide a variety of input

¬Include many study trips

¬Invite resource people with ideas and things to share

¬Use manipulatives and real materials

¬Build from interest of learners

¬Work from real events and materials

 

More suggestions

¬Attend to children’s multiple intelligences

¬Demonstrate

¬Have plants, animals and appropriate decorations

¬Use thematic and integrated approaches
